Olive Oil is Nature’s Health Food

Not all fat is created equal! That’s good to know for those of us who want to eat healthy but love food. Some fats, like saturated fats, are heart-clogging messes, but others — like omega-3 and olive oil are healthy fats that actually work to unclog your arteries and boost your brainpower. Olive oil is high in mono-unsaturated fat, and has been shown to improve memory.

The Mediterranean Diet has become popular recently because researchers have found that those living in that area of the world, and consume a diet high in fish and olive oil, suffer fewer strokes and heart attacks, and are much healthier than those who eat foods high in fat — or fast food. Clogged arteries restrict the flow of blood and oxygen throughout the body, and that means to the brain as well. Your brain functions best when its nutrients and oxygen supply are coming into its cells unrestricted.

In Italy, where olive oil always has been an integral part of the culture, olive oil has long been known for its health benefits and healing properties. They use it for anything from sunburn and earaches to dry hair.
